My journey into the message Shane Claiborne gives started with reading Irresistible Revolution, a book he authored several years ago. From there I was hooked, Shane's message comes from the words of Jesus in scripture and is a message of love for all of God's people on this earth. He lives a life of simplicity, in community and shares Jesus every step of the way. He calls all of us to reach out to the poor, keep our eyes open for injustice among the weak and weary, to live sacrificial lives for the cause of Christ. His message is not new, it is over 2000 years old.

I had never heard Shane speak live. There are several You Tube clips you can pull up on him, but I guess I just wanted to experience what he said from the stage at Summit for the first time in person. I was surprised to hear a slight Tennessee twang, as he lives in Philadelphia now, among the poor. He has served along side Mother Teresa in India, he has served those with Leprocy in one of her homes. One thing I did not expect was to hear him speak so graciously. With the message he has been called to share he could have left all of us in a pool of guilt and anger trying to justify our living the "not so simple way." His words were full of mercy and inspiration, along with humor to help us all take in what he had to say in an easier fashion. He is truly gifted by God. He makes you want to live a better life, a better story, pouring into a story that makes a difference to people, God's story. He called us all to the cause of Christ.

For those of us who hear this story of serving the poor, and see Shane who lives among them, we can walk away from this experience and be conflicted, feeling like we aren't truly embracing this cause unless we do give away everything and become poor ourselves. The scripture he referred to in this was the "If a man has two tunic's and one man has none, you should give him one of yours." We just need to share what God has given us with others, our giftedness and our stuff. Whatever we do we should use our gifts for Christ. If we are a lawyer we can be serving Christ with that, if we are a doctor we can serve Christ with that. God can use all people on earth to share His love with those we come in contact with.
